The "Here We Go!" Factor: What it Means for Chelsea Fans

Now, let's talk about the phrase that sends shivers of excitement down every football fan's spine: "Here we go!". When Fabrizio Romano utters these four words in relation to a Chelsea transfer, it signifies that a deal is 100% done, agreed upon by all parties, and ready to be announced. This isn't just a confirmation; it's the culmination of weeks, sometimes months, of intense negotiations, background checks, and personal terms discussions. For Chelsea fans, hearing "Here we go!" is like receiving a golden ticket. It means that the player you've been dreaming of, or perhaps a vital addition you didn't even realize you needed, is officially on their way to Stamford Bridge. Romano's credibility is so immense that once he says "Here we go!", you can pretty much put the official announcement in your calendar. He often provides details about the transfer fee, the length of the contract, and sometimes even the player's jersey number, which adds to the tangible excitement. Navigating the Transfer Window: Tips from Romano's Reports

Alright, guys, let's talk strategy. Navigating the chaotic world of the football transfer window can be a wild ride, but with insights from Fabrizio Romano, we can approach it like seasoned pros. One of the biggest takeaways from his reporting is the importance of patience. Transfer windows are marathons, not sprints. Deals can take weeks, even months, to materialize, and sometimes they fall apart at the last minute. Romano often emphasizes that "things are developing" or that "talks are ongoing," which are crucial phrases indicating that while there might be interest, nothing is set in stone. He's also a master at distinguishing between genuine interest and media speculation. He'll often clarify if a club is merely monitoring a player, having initial contact, or if they are actively in negotiations. This helps us avoid getting caught up in every single rumor that pops up. Another key tip is to pay attention to the sources he mentions. Romano rarely pulls information out of thin air. He'll often attribute information to "sources close to the player," "club officials," or "intermediaries involved in the deal." This transparency builds trust and allows us to gauge the reliability of the information. He also highlights the significance of player motivation. Is the player pushing for a move? Are they happy at their current club? These personal factors can be just as important as the financial terms between clubs. Romano's reports often shed light on the player's perspective, which is vital for understanding the dynamics of a transfer. Furthermore, he stresses the importance of due diligence. Clubs don't just sign players randomly. They conduct extensive scouting, medical assessments, and personality evaluations. Romano's insights often reflect this rigorous process, giving us a sense of the calculated decisions being made by the clubs. Finally, he reminds us that the market is fluid. Player values change, priorities shift, and unexpected opportunities arise. What seems like a done deal one day can be completely different the next. By following Romano's updates, we get a real-time understanding of this dynamic environment.
